What is Gaming Fairness?
Gaming fairness refers to the assurance that games are unbiased and that all players have an equal chance of winning. This is vital for maintaining trust between the casino and its players.

What Are Audits and Why Are They Important?
Audits are thorough evaluations of the casino’s games and systems by independent experts. These audits check for fairness, security, and compliance with regulations set by the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C).
Who Conducts These Audits?
Reputable auditing firms, such as eCOGRA or iTech Labs, perform these checks. They assess everything from the software used in games to the payout percentages, ensuring that Moana Casino meets strict standards.

Common Myths about Gaming Fairness
- Myth: Games are rigged against players.
- Truth: Licensed casinos like Moana must adhere to strict regulations that ensure fairness.
- Myth: Higher RTP means guaranteed winnings.
- Truth: RTP is a long-term average; individual sessions can vary significantly.
- Myth: Audits are unnecessary if a casino has a good reputation.
- Truth: Regular audits are essential for maintaining trust and integrity.
How Often Are Games Audited?
Games should be audited regularly, typically at least once a year. This ensures that any changes in software or game mechanics are still compliant with fairness standards.
What Happens If a Casino Fails an Audit?
If a casino fails an audit, it could face penalties from the regulatory body, including fines or even the loss of its licence. This ensures that player interests are protected.
